Keswick, located in the picturesque Lake District of Cumbria, North of England, is a charming market town that attracts visitors with its vibrant array of shops, pubs, restaurants, and bars. This bustling locale is not only a hub for social activities but also offers numerous tourist attractions, including museums, climbing walls, and entertaining crazy golf courses. Just under a mile away lies the stunning Derwentwater, where guests can indulge in various activities such as sunbathing on the beach, leisurely walks around the lake, or renting a rowing boat. For those seeking a more relaxed experience, the Keswick Launch provides scenic cruises with a convenient hop on/hop off service, allowing access to various popular lakeside spots.

Outdoor enthusiasts will find themselves in an ideal location, as Keswick serves as a gateway to some of England’s most renowned hiking trails. With Scafell Pike, the highest mountain in England, just 8 miles away, and other notable peaks like Skiddaw and Blencathra within 5 and 6 miles respectively, walkers are presented with a plethora of options to explore the breathtaking landscapes of the Lake District. This makes the town not only a destination for relaxation but also a prime spot for adventure and exploration.
